DetailsDescription:
The desktop file provided by the firefox package ('/usr/share/applications/firefox.desktop') uses the full path of the executable ('Exec=/usr/lib/firefox/firefox'). I would like to make a wrapper script, which is allowed in other applications' desktop files, however I cannot without editing the desktop file. Using 'Exec=firefox' allows for this and does not sacrifice any compatibility/functionality. Additional info: * package version(s) 66.0.2-1 * config and/or log files etc. * link to upstream bug report, if any Steps to reproduce: Create a script named "firefox" in one of the directories located in "$PATH", execute firefox via the desktop entry, observe the desired script not get executed. |
